Another one that surfaced recently. An undated (or scrubbed) early (maybe 1910 before they started dating the receivers) DWM with military proofs on the right side. Seems to meet the rework criteria with commercial proofs, but the head is upside down. Like another one posted previously, it has a mismatched Erfurt side plate. I'll go out on a limb and call this one legit.
